I currently have a domain (camerarc.com) the web site for which is being hosted at a different provider. I'm in the process of moving my web hosting to WHH but I have a question regarding subdomains. In addition to the web site at camerarc.com, I also have a subdomain activate.camerarc.com that hosts an activation server. Unfortunately this is an asp service that needs to remain at the existing hosting provider.

So what I want to do is move my camerarc.com web site to WHH while still having the subdomain located at the current Windows hosting provider. I currently have the new web site set up at camerarc.jpro51.com, and I will probably just redirect to here for the time being, but my goal is to actually get camerarc.com on the WHH servers. So is there a way to set up the DNS so that the activate.camerarc.com is located at a different hosting provider? I've tried to use redirection, but I don't think that will work with the asp service.

Any help you can provide is appreciated.

Hello,

Thank you for your question on hosting a subdomain at another host. You can certainly do this. You can simply create an A record for your domain to point to the other hosting server's IP address. Then once you point your domain to our servers, it will automatically redirect anything going to the subdomain to that other host.
